This last weekend, CHD had their continuing education class. I was asked to be a model in the class. There were 50 barbers in attendance. My instructor, Ferida, took me from a level 5 red, to a level 10 blonde....we said our prayers, and somebody must have been listening, because it worked. 


 First, she used Elimin8 - it's a product that strips artificial color from hair. It doesn't usually work very well, and stripping red from hair is the hardest thing to do (I'm told), so we were thrilled when the red pulled to this lovely honey color you see poking out here! Ferida then foiled the crap out of my hair, alternating sizes of weave and volumes of bleach, to create depth and dimension.
